Factors to Consider When Choosing Usb C Lapdocking Station

Choosing the right usb c lapdocking station involves understanding key factors that influence compatibility, usability, and longevity. Beyond just port count, consider how the dock fits your workflow, the quality of the build, and whether it supports your laptop’s power and display needs. Being aware of common pitfalls can help you avoid overspending on unnecessary features or ending up with a device that doesn’t work reliably with your laptop. Here are the most important factors to keep in mind:

Compatibility with Your Laptop and Devices

Not all docking stations work seamlessly with every laptop, especially when it comes to power delivery and video output. Check whether the dock supports your laptop’s USB-C or Thunderbolt specifications, and verify the maximum power output to ensure it can charge your device effectively. Some docks are optimized for specific brands like Dell or HP, which may offer better compatibility and performance. Failing to match these specifications can result in poor performance or non-functionality, so double-check compatibility before purchasing.

Number and Types of Ports

Assess your connectivity needs carefully—more ports provide greater flexibility, but can also increase size and cost. For most users, a combination of HDMI or DisplayPort outputs for multiple monitors, USB-A and USB-C ports for peripherals, and Ethernet is essential. Consider whether your workflow requires SD card slots or audio jacks, and look for docks that balance port variety with a manageable size. Overloading on ports might seem appealing, but it can lead to clutter and higher price tags without practical benefit.

Power Delivery Capacity

Fast, reliable charging is a key advantage of modern lapdocks, especially if you want a single cable setup. Make sure the dock provides enough wattage—ideally 85W or higher—to power your laptop while in use. Some docks offer 65W or less, which may suffice for smaller laptops but could slow down charging or drain the battery during intense workloads. Investing in a dock with higher power output can improve usability, but it might also increase cost and size.

Size, Portability, and Setup

If portability is a priority, look for compact docks that still meet your port needs. Larger, more feature-rich docks tend to stay stationary on your desk, while smaller models can be portable companions for travel or flexible workspaces. Additionally, consider how easy it is to set up and connect—some docks have plug-and-play design, whereas others require drivers or specific configurations. Balance your space constraints against the need for flexibility and ease of use.

Price and Long-Term Value

Pricing varies widely based on features, build quality, and brand reputation. Higher-priced options often deliver more durable construction, better compatibility, and additional ports or features, but may not be necessary for casual users. Conversely, budget models might lack certain functionalities or reliability over time. Think about your long-term needs—investing in a slightly more expensive, dependable dock can save money and frustration in the long run.

Frequently Asked Questions

Will a cheaper USB C docking station work with my laptop?

While some budget docks can work with your laptop, their performance and compatibility are less predictable. Lower-cost options may lack sufficient power delivery, support fewer monitors, or have limited port options, which could hamper your workflow. It’s important to verify compatibility specifications and reviews to ensure the dock will meet your needs before making a purchase. Investing in a slightly higher-priced model might provide better long-term reliability and performance.

Can I connect multiple monitors to a USB C dock?

Many modern USB C docks support dual or even triple monitor setups, especially those with DisplayPort or HDMI outputs designed for high-resolution displays. However, the ability to run multiple monitors smoothly depends on your laptop’s graphics capabilities and the dock’s specifications. Always check whether the dock supports the resolution and refresh rate you need across all monitors. Some docks may limit performance or resolution when connecting three displays, so choose accordingly based on your workflow demands.

Do I need a specific brand of USB C dock for my laptop?

While many docks are compatible across brands, some are optimized for specific ecosystems like Dell, HP, or MacBooks, offering better performance or plug-and-play functionality. For example, Thunderbolt docks are tailored for compatible devices, providing faster data transfer and higher power delivery. Using a dock designed for your laptop brand can simplify setup and improve reliability, but universal docks with broad compatibility are also available. Always review compatibility details before buying.

Is a higher wattage power delivery necessary for my laptop?

Yes, if you want your dock to reliably charge your laptop while in use, selecting a model with higher wattage—preferably 85W or more—is advisable. Lower wattage docks might slow down charging or fail to keep your battery topped up during intensive tasks. The right power delivery ensures a seamless experience, especially for larger, power-hungry laptops. Consider your device’s charging requirements carefully to avoid performance issues.

What should I prioritize: port variety or portability?

This depends on your primary use case. If you need a versatile setup with multiple peripherals and monitors, prioritize docks with a wide array of ports—even if they are larger and stay on your desk. Conversely, if mobility is key, look for compact, lightweight models that can easily fit into a bag, even if they have fewer ports. Balancing your workflow needs with portability will help you choose a dock that complements your lifestyle without compromise.
